Mixed-use scheme would add new education space to school site formerly known as The Cass
AHMM is drawing up plans to redevelop the London Met’s former School of Architecture site as a mixed-use scheme including a 22-storey student accommodation tower.
The practice is working with the Prudential Assurance Company and the City of London Corporation on the Calcutta House site in Aldgate on the eastern edge of the Square Mile.
